What Causes Soreness In The Breasts?

I had a lump under my armpit like a month ago and it stardet very painful and the size of a grape it got smaller every week and the pain as well went away and it took like a month to go but now my boobs are hurting like as if you were like pinching them and idk what could it be nor my mother knows

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i,

You should rule out mastitis like breast inflammation condition. For that, it's advisable to investigate with ultrasonography of local part.

Meanwhile, anti-inflammatory medication like brufen can be prescribed. You can consult nearby surgeon for examination and management accordingly.
